Seven years in Hanoi’s prisons did not dim Robbie Risner’s fighting spirit (Larson, Risner)

T he picture on the Time magazine cover for April 23, 1965, was Air Force Lt. Col. Robinson Risner. The cover story, “The Fighting American,” featured 10 US military members in Vietnam, with fighter pilot Risner—a rising star in the Air Force—foremost among them.
